WebPolystyrene offcuts from building applications can be recovered and recycled during the construction process. Foamex supply bags for clean-up on site and work closely with contractors to pick up unused waste or end-of-use polystyrene, transport it safely to our manufacturing facility, and granulate it for reuse. WebPolystyrene. Polystyrene (PS) is a polymer made from the monomer styrene, a liquid hydrocarbon that is commercially manufactured from petroleum. At room temperature, PS is normally a solid thermoplastic but can be melted at higher temperature for moulding or extrusion, then resolidified. WebThe plastic resin code for polystyrene is #6. It is not usually taken by curbside recycling programs in most places but can be recycled via special recycling programs. In 2016 the …
